摘  要:
本试验旨在研究富硒酵母和枯草芽孢杆菌对湖羊断奶羔羊小肠黏膜形态和直肠菌群的影响。选取体况良好、体重为(9.65±0.38) kg的湖羊断奶羔羊21只,随机分为3组,即对照组、富硒酵母组和枯草芽孢杆菌组,每组7只羊。对照组饲喂基础饲粮,试验组分别按照100 g/t的比例在精料中添加富硒酵母和枯草芽孢杆菌制剂。试验期为28 d。结果表明:1)与对照组相比,富硒酵母组和枯草芽孢杆菌组的十二指肠、空肠、回肠的绒毛高度显著提高(P<0.05),十二指肠和回肠的隐窝深度显著降低(P<0.05),空肠的隐窝深度极显著降低(P<0.01),十二指肠和空肠的绒毛高和隐窝深度比值(V/C)极显著提高(P<0.01),回肠V/C显著提高(P<0.05)。2)富硒酵母和枯草芽孢杆菌的添加影响了湖羊羔羊直肠菌群的α多样性,使得直肠菌群在纲、目、科、属、种水平上呈现不同的丰度差异。综上得出,在饲粮中添加富硒酵母和枯草芽孢杆菌能够促进湖羊羔羊小肠各段的发育,增加直肠有益菌群的丰度,降低有害菌群的增殖。

摘  要:
The present experiment was conducted to evaluate the effects of selenium-enriched yeast and Bacillus subtilis on intestinal mucosal morphology and rectum microflora of Hu lambs.Twenty-one Hu Lambs,weighted(9.65±0.38) kg,were divided into 3 groups:control group,selenium-enriched yeast group and Bacillus subtilis group,with 7 lambs per group.The lambs in the control group were fed a basal diet,and in experimental groups,100 g/t selenium-enriched yeast and Bacillus subtilis were added into concentrate,respectively.The experiment lasted for 28 days.The results showed as follow s:1) compared with the control group,the villus height of duodenum,jejunum and ileum in the selenium enriched yeast group and Bacillus subtilis group significantly increased(P<0.05);the crypt depth of duodenum and ileum significantly decreased(P<0.05),while the crypt depth of jejunum significantly decreased(P<0.01);the villus height to crypt depth ratio(V/C) of duodenum and jejunum significantly increased(P<0.01),and the V/C of ileum significantly increased(P <0.05).2) The supplement of selenium-enriched yeast and Bacillus subtilis affected the α diversity of the rectal flora of Hu lambs,resulting in different abundances of the rectal flora at the levels of the class,order,family,genus,species.It is concluded that the supplement of selenium enriched yeast and Bacillus subtilis in the diet can significantly enhance the development of the small intestine of lambs,increase the abundance of beneficial rectum microflora and reduce the proliferation of harmful bacteria.
